One of the first feature films directed by an African American woman, Kathleen Collins’s LOSING GROUND tells the story of a marriage between two remarkable people, both at a crossroads in their lives. Sara Rogers, a black professor of philosophy, is embarking on an intellectual quest to understand “ecstasy” just as her painter husband, Victor, sets off on a more earthy exploration of joy. Presented on 16mm from the UWM Cinema Arts Archive
(Kathleen Collins, USA, English, 86 min, 1982, 16mm)
